In Registry schreiben obwohl User keine Berechtigung hat?

Chrislybaer

Lt. Junior Grade
Registriert
Aug. 2003
Beiträge
313
Hallo

Ich habe hier ein kleines Problem...
Situation ist die folgende:
Die User dürfen nicht in die Registry schreiben.
Ich habe hier jedoch ein Programm, wo einige Einstellungen in der Registry gespeichert sind. Und zwar unter "Current User"... (Also eine Computerrichtlinie bringt hier nichts...)
Ich hätte sogar ein Skript, welches die Einstellungen bei der Anmeldung der User setzt. Bei den Usern, die zwar "regedit" nicht ausführen dürfen, jedoch in die Registry schreiben dürfen, bei denen funktioniert das ganze auch und die Einstellungen werden gesetzt.
Nur wie gesagt, bei den Usern, die nicht in die Registry schreiben dürfen, funktioniert es nicht...

In dem Skript sieht eine Zeile z.B. so aus:
Code:
WshShell.RegWrite"HKCU\Software\sw4you\Hardcopy\Toolbar\14.600\-Bar0\Bar#6", 59402, "REG_DWORD"


Einige Zeilen sehen aber auch so aus:
Code:
oReg.SetDWORDValue HKEY_CURRENT_USER, "Software\sw4you\Hardcopy\Toolbar\14.600\-Bar10", "MRUDockTopPos", 4294967295


Bevor ich jetzt jedoch das ganze Skript in die zweite Variante umschreibe, wollte ich von euch wissen, ob ihr vielleicht wisst, ob es dann überhaupt funktioniert..

Bzw. hat jemand von euch eine andere Idee?? z.B. dass ich in das Skript etwas einfüge, dass die Einträge unter einem anderem Benutzer ausführe oder sowas... (falls sowas überhaupt geht..) ??

Ich hoffe, dass mir jemand helfen kann...

Viele Grüsse,
Chris G.
 
AW: In Registry schreiben obwohl User keine Berechtigung hat??

Hallo

Kann mir bei diesem Problem wirklich keine helfen??

Bin schon für den kleinsten Tipp dankbar...

Schöne Grüsse,
Chris G.
 
AW: In Registry schreiben obwohl User keine Berechtigung hat??

Naja, nicht umsonst gibt es die Option Ausfühern als! ;)

Wenn du eine Domänenumgebung hast, dann kannst du den Usern zur Zeit der Installation schreibrechte auf die Schlüssel geben.
 
AW: In Registry schreiben obwohl User keine Berechtigung hat??

Hallo eraz, vielen Dank für deine Antwort :-)

Das Ausführen als hab ich ja schon probiert, aber das geht nicht mit .vbs-Dateien ;-) (Zumindest hab ich es nicht hingekriegt... ;-) )

Hmm, ja hier besteht eine Domänenstruktur... Allerdings weiss ich grad nicht wie ich den Usern zur Zeit der Installation Rechte auf die Schlüssel geben kann..
Ich habe auch schonmal gehört, dass man best. Programmen (In diesem Fall die .vbs-Datei) Vollrecht (Admin-Recht) geben kann...

Kannst du (oder gerne auch jemand anderes ;-) ) mir kurz erklären, wie ich eines der beiden Dinge anstelle??

Vielen Dank :-)
Chris G.
 
AW: In Registry schreiben obwohl User keine Berechtigung hat??

Wenn du eine Domäne hast dann ist ja eh alles Perfekt. Dann Teilst du den Usern einfach für den nächsten Start das Skript zu (per Grupenrichtlinie) und sobald sie das nächste mal neu Starten wird's (unter Admin Rechten) ausgeführt.

PS: Übrigens gibts auf der Kommandozeile den Befehl runas ;)
 
Zurück
Oben